Commercial Property Demolition in Houston, TX

Commercial property demolition services involve the controlled removal of existing structures on commercial sites, including office buildings, retail centers, warehouses, and other large-scale facilities. These projects typically require careful planning to ensure the safe and efficient teardown of structures, often to prepare the site for redevelopment or new construction. Property owners interested in this service should consider factors such as the size and type of the building, the presence of hazardous materials, and any local regulations or permits that may be required before beginning demolition.

Before requesting commercial demolition,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, including what parts of the structure will be removed and how debris will be managed. It is also important to clarify the timeline, potential disruptions to the surrounding area, and any necessary permits or approvals. Proper planning helps ensure the demolition process aligns with project goals, safety standards, and local requirements, making it a crucial step in site redevelopment or renovation projects.

Project Types

Common Commercial Property Demolition Jobs

Commercial building demolition - involves safely tearing down office buildings, warehouses, or retail spaces.

Structural removal services - include removing specific sections or structures within a commercial property.

Interior demolition - focuses on clearing out interior spaces for renovations or repurposing.

Partial demolition - removes designated parts of a property while keeping the rest intact.

Site clearing and debris removal - prepares the land for new development by removing old structures and waste.

Industrial demolition - handles the dismantling of manufacturing plants and large industrial facilities.

FAQ

Commercial Property Demolition Questions

What types of commercial properties can be demolished? Demolition services typically include warehouses, retail stores, office buildings, and industrial facilities.

What should property owners consider before demolition? It's important to evaluate site access, utility disconnections, and environmental regulations prior to demolition.

Are permits required for commercial demolition projects? Yes, permits are usually necessary to ensure compliance with local building and safety codes.

What is the purpose of commercial demolition? The goal is to safely remove existing structures to prepare for new development or renovations.
